Touch-a-Truck event in Davie offers children the chance to explore big trucks and heavy machinery on May 3, 2025

Published

on

Davie, Florida – The Town of Davie is excited to announce the return of its popular annual Touch-a-Truck event on Saturday, May 3, 2025, from 9 a.m. to 12 p.m. at the Bergeron Rodeo Grounds, located at 4201 Rodeo Way. This family-friendly event is set to provide an exciting opportunity for children and families to get up close and personal with a wide range of trucks and heavy machinery, making for an unforgettable day of exploration and hands-on learning.

Touch-a-Truck has become a beloved tradition in Davie, offering a fun and educational experience for children of all ages. This year, the event will feature an impressive collection of vehicles, including fire engines, construction trucks, sanitation vehicles, and more. These large machines, which are essential to the daily operations of the town, will be on display for children to explore, climb into, and discover the inner workings of the machinery that helps keep Davie running smoothly. Local professionals who operate these vehicles will be on hand to answer questions and share insights into the vital services these trucks provide to the community.

In a thoughtful gesture for those with sensory sensitivities, the event will kick off with a horn-free, sensory-friendly hour from 9 to 10 a.m. This time will allow children who may be sensitive to loud noises a quieter, more comfortable experience as they interact with the trucks and machinery. The rest of the event will remain loud and lively, but this dedicated hour ensures everyone has the chance to enjoy the fun.

The festivities won’t stop with just the trucks. Attendees can also enjoy a variety of additional activities throughout the event. In celebration of Davie’s centennial year, there will be a special table dedicated to the Town of Davie’s 100th anniversary, offering fun facts and memorabilia. A live DJ will be spinning tunes to keep the energy high, and there will be free kids’ activities to entertain the younger crowd. The event is designed to keep families engaged and entertained for hours.

Food and beverages will be available for purchase throughout the event. While outside food and beverages will not be permitted, the on-site vendors will ensure there’s something delicious for everyone to enjoy. With the beautiful weather of early May, it’s the perfect time to bring the whole family out for a morning of fun in the sun.

Admission to Touch-a-Truck is free, making it an affordable outing for families to enjoy together. Whether your child is fascinated by fire trucks or simply loves big machines, this event is sure to leave everyone with a smile.
